This document discusses postmodern elements that are commonly featured in music videos, such as irony, pastiche, intertextuality, and cultural flattening. It provides Lady Gaga's "Telephone" music video as an example, analyzing how the video uses postmodern techniques like pastiche by imitating cinema conventions, lacks a strong narrative message, engages in cultural flattening through provocative content, and has intertextual references and a disjunctive relationship between the song and video. The document also notes the video's use of product placement through cinematography.
